Revelation 2:19 — Bible Verse (KJV)
“I know thy works, and charity, and service, and faith, and thy patience, and thy works; and the last to be more than the first.”

Revelation 2:19 WEB — World English Bible (2000)
““I know your works, your love, faith, service, patient endurance, and that your last works are more than the first.”
Revelation 2:19 — World English Bible
Revelation 2:19 ASV — American Standard Version (1901)
“I know thy works, and thy love and faith and ministry and patience, and that thy last works are more than the first.”
Revelation 2:19 — American Standard Version
Revelation 2:19 YLT — Young's Literal Translation (1862)
“I have known thy works, and love, and ministration, and faith, and thy endurance, and thy works--and the last <FI>are<Fi> more than the first.”
Revelation 2:19 — Young's Literal Translation
Revelation 2:19 DBY — Darby Translation (1890)
“I know thy works, and love, and faith, and service, and thine endurance, and thy last works [to be] more than the first.”
Revelation 2:19 — Darby Translation
Revelation 2:19 GEN — Geneva Bible (1599)
“I knowe thy workes and thy loue, and seruice, and faith, and thy patience, and thy workes, and that they are more at the last, then at the first.”
